A course like that, modeled on MIT OpenCourseWare, would need a solid structure. Based on how MIT organizes its high-level courses, here's a suggested approach for an "Aging Reversal Genetics" syllabus, and some thoughts on the "Virtual Earth" concept:
Syllabus Structure
To maintain a rigorous, MIT-style approach, the course should balance foundational knowledge with cutting-edge research and practical application.
Part 1: Foundational Genetics and Aging Biology (The "Why" and "How")
Review of core molecular genetics, gene regulation, and epigenetics.
In-depth exploration of the Hallmarks of Aging (e.g., genomic instability, telomere attrition, cellular senescence) .
Model organisms in aging research (yeast, C. elegans, mice).
Part 2: Genetic Interventions for Reversal (The "Tools")
Detailed study of Genome Engineering technologies like CRISPR/Cas9 for therapeutic editing.
Gene therapy delivery methods (like AAV vectors) and multiplex editing challenges (a key area of Dr. Church's work).
Cellular reprogramming and rejuvenation via Yamanaka Factors (OSK, OSKM).
Part 3: Translational Research and Ethics (The "Future")
Current human clinical trials and translational hurdles for aging reversal.
Synthetic Biology applications (e.g., engineering resistance to all viruses).
Ethical, Legal, and Social Implications (ELSI) of radical longevity.
MIT courses often use weekly paper discussions (Journal Club) and group-based experimental design projects as major components. For grading, an MIT-style breakdown might be fifty percent on data analysis/project work, and the rest split between presentations, written assignments, and exams.
The "Realistic Virtual Earth" Concept
This is where the course can become truly innovative. Instead of a single "Earth," you could conceptualize two distinct, but interconnected digital simulation environments:
Virtual Earth for Genetics (The Genome Lab): A high-fidelity simulator for genetic experimentation. Students could use it to:
Perform virtual multiplex gene editing on a model organism genome (like a synthetic E. coli or mouse line).
Run virtual in silico screens for longevity-associated genes.
Visualize and predict the effects of different gene drive mechanisms on a simulated population over time.
Virtual Earth for Aging Reversal (The Longevity Ecosystem): A complex, systems-level model focused on the whole organism and population. Students could:
Test different interventions (genetic, chemical, lifestyle) on a simulated, diverse population, observing effects on lifespan and healthspan.
Model the epigenetic clocks and see how different therapies reverse or accelerate them.
Simulate the ethical and economic impact of successful reversal therapies on global populations and resource allocation.
The key to the "realistic" part is grounding the simulations in large, real-world datasets and computational models used in contemporary research, like those for genome-wide association studies or drug screening.
